A simple material such as PVC pipes can be used to make a trellis suitable for growing cucumbers. It is easy-to-build and allows for you to adjust the height. Unlike traditional trellises, PVC trellises are sturdy and durable enough to support the weight of dangling fruit and foliage. They can be used as shelving. Another option is to use a broken patio umbrella as a trestle for the plant. This trellis is capable of holding four plants.

Branch from your own tree can be used to make a trellis. The tree branches can be cut at the proper height to make the structure taller. Try building an A-frame trellis so that there is plenty of room underneath the structure. Once you have a sturdy and stable trellis, tie it to the ground with ushaped pins.

Remember that cucumber trellise should not be fancy. A reclaimed bike rim or fallen branch can be used to make a trellis. These materials are low-cost and easily accessible. They can also be used to grow other crops. Simple trellis are great for smaller cucumber vines. Once the vines are long enough, they will cross the top and form an attractive canopy.


If you are looking for an easy and affordable way to grow cucumbers, you can use wooden panels or even metal garden fencing. The trellis should be three feet tall and at least 36 inches away from the ground. The trellis should be strong so that vines can hold onto it. The trellis should be placed in a way that vines can easily wrap around it.

Adding a trellis to your cucumbers is a simple DIY project. A cucumber trellis is a great way to help your vines achieve their full potential. Once they begin to produce, picking them will be easy without any assistance. You should ensure that they have enough sunlight. The trellis should support your vines and not be a hindrance.

String trellis to grow cucumbers is the easiest and best way to do so. You can also use bamboo or reclaimed timber trellis instead of plastic. A string trellis will hold large fruits and is easy to construct. Depending on your garden's size and shape, a teepee trestle will fit your cucumbers and provide the space they need to grow.

What is the difference between aquaponic gardening or hydroponic?

Hydroponic gardening is a method that uses water to nourish plants instead of soil. Aquaponics blends fish tanks with plants to create a self sufficient ecosystem. It's almost like having a farm right at home.
